>OK, budu teda přesnější. Mělo by to být něco na bázi primary key, teda >jedinečné číslo, které se mi vždy po odeslání (ne po zobrazení) formuláře >zvýší o jedno (kvůli identifikaci formuláře). Mělo by to být v normálním >poli text (input type=text) a nemělo by být možno ho přepsat. > >M.Z. Ak sa nema dat prepisat nie je zbytocne ho davat do input? Mozno by bolo vhodnejsie, niekde hore v rohu napisat to cislo. Ukladaj si to do suboru, alebo pouzi databazu: Ak stlaci "odoslat": $subor = "pocitadlo.txt"; $fp = FOpen($subor, "r+"); $hits = FGetS($fp, 250) + 1; Rewind ($fp); FPutS ($fp, $hits); FClose ($fp); Alebo databaza napriklad: // zvysime pocitadlo $vysledok = MySQL_Query("UPDATE meno_tabulky SET hits = hits + 1'"); if (!$vysledok): echo "Nepodarilo sa vlozit do databázy "; exit; endif; //precitame pocitadlo $vysledok = MySQL_Query("SELECT * from meno_tabulky'"); if (!$vysledok): echo "Nepodaril sa výber z databázy "; exit; endif; $zaznam = MySQL_Fetch_Array($vysledok); echo $zaznam["hits"]; Lasky
This archive was generated by hypermail 2.1.2 : 07. 03. 2002, 10:12 CET